The engine codes are 21 which suggests an oxygen sensor has stopped functioning (probably the upstream) and 34 which suggests a problem with the cruise control. Those don't relate to the pressure switch issues shown on the trans controller so I'd focus on the trans to get it out of limp in. The OD and 2/4 pressure switches (codes 21 and 22) are in the solenoid box so ideally you won't have to r&r the trans but rather check their wiring and if that doesn't yield a fault deal with the pressure switches in that box.
